Sign Language Interpreter in Portales, NM
Step into an impactful role supporting young learners as a part-time Sign Language Interpreter for the 2026/2027 academic year. In this contracted position, you will provide dedicated 1:1 interpreting services for a Pre-K4 student, helping to facilitate seamless communication and a positive early learning experience. The position offers approximately 24 hours of work per week, fostering meaningful connections while maintaining a flexible schedule.
What you’ll bring:
- Proficiency in American Sign Language (ASL)
- Previous experience as a Sign Language Interpreter, ideally in an educational setting
- Ability to interpret conversations and classroom activities for young children
- Comfort working one-on-one within a Pre-K environment
- Strong collaboration and communication skills with teachers and support staff
- Relevant licensure or certification as required by state regulations
Key responsibilities:
- Deliver accurate, age-appropriate interpretation for a Pre-K4 student during instructional and non-instructional activities
- Facilitate understanding between the student, peers, and school staff
- Support classroom inclusion and engagement throughout the school day
- Collaborate with educators to adapt interpreting approaches for early childhood comprehension
- Maintain confidentiality and professionalism consistent with district and legal requirements
